Mixing elements of R&B and soul with their jazz roots, Kiana & the Sun Kings make music that is modern yet timeless, energetic yet contemplative. It is their ultimate goal to make music that dabbles equally in complexity and simplicity, crafting sounds for the musician and casual listener alike. Since their formation in 2017, the band has gained traction from their beloved home base, Louisville KY, and spread that love to surrounding midwestern cities and beyond sharing bills with notable acts like Joslyn & the Sweet Compression, Bendigo Fletcher, Moon Taxi, and Nappy Roots. With the release of their debut EP “Chrysalis,” this fiery septet continues to push the sonic envelope. Their sophomore EP entitled “Monarch” is set to release Fall 2022.

 

Kiana & the Sun Kings are:

Kiana Del - vocals
Matt McKay - flute
Trevin Little - saxophone
Harris Boyer - guitar
DéQuan Tunstull - piano
Phillip Bullock - electric bass
Fiona Palensky - drums
